This set of pages lists the walks which may be reached in a (slightly generous) hour’s travel from a London rail terminus. It does not suggest that the entire walk referenced may be walked from London termini, just that you may make contact with the walk. Due to the multiplicity of rail routes to the south and south-east of London out of Victoria, Charing Cross, Blackfriars, Cannon Street and London Bridge, these are grouped by rail company rather than by station.

The notes below indicate the farthest stations considered for inclusion.

Fenchurch Street (FST)
All stations from this station.

Liverpool Street (LST)
Stations as far as Ipswich, and on the branch lines south of Ipswich; stations as far as Cambridge, and on the branch lines south of Bishop’s Stortford.

King’s Cross (KGX)
Stations as far as Cambridge and Grantham.

St Pancras (STP)
Stations as far as Leicester, and most stations on the High Speed line.

Euston (EUS)
Stations as far as Coventry and Nuneaton.

Marylebone (MYB)
All stations on the Aylesbury and Oxford lines, and as far as Banbury on the Birmingham line.

Paddington (PAD)
Stations as far as Oxford, Kemble, Chippenham and Pewsey.

Waterloo (WAT)
Stations as far as Wokingham, Basingstoke, Winchester, Petersfield, Dorking and Horsham.

Southern Railway
Stations as far as Billingshurst, Brighton and Lewes.

Southeastern
Stations as far as Wadhurst, Canterbury, Dover and Faversham.
